Jump to content
    

Vivado не дает задать топ модуль

Всем доброго дня!

Начал работать в Vivado 2018.2, а после и с 2021.1, при создании проекта программа не определяет топ модуль, и даже не дает сделать это вручную. 

Кроме того в консоле имеется критический warning 

[filemgmt 20-2001] Source scanning failed (launch error) while processing fileset "sources_1" due to unrecoverable syntax error or design hierarchy issues. Recovering last known analysis of the source files.

Синтаксических ошибок естественно нет.

Ранее у меня подобное было когда в имени компьютера или в пути проекта были русские буквы, сейчас такого нет. 

Проблема, вероятнее всего, заключается в том, что версия Windows10 на моем ПК не поддерживается данными версиями Vivado. 

Может кто-то сталкивался с подобным? Есть какие то решения проблемы, кроме как потратить более 100 ГБ места на ПК, установив более свежую Vivado?

Share this post


Link to post
Share on other sites

On 12/9/2025 at 9:11 AM, Runi said:

Начал работать в Vivado 2018.2, а после и с 2021.1, при создании проекта программа не определяет топ модуль, и даже не дает сделать это вручную. 

А сколько модулей инстанцировано в топе?

Команда Refresh Hierarchy помогает?

У меня во всех версиях Vivado за исключением Vivado 2016.4 периодически ломается иерархия.

Иногда помогает команда Refresh Hierarchy, иногда приходится создавать проект заново.

Но у меня в топе больше трехсот модулей.

Share this post


Link to post
Share on other sites

Даже если в проекте один модуль ситуация идентична.  Создавал простой проект, вивадо не определяет топ модуль.

 Refresh Hierarchy - не помогает

Share this post


Link to post
Share on other sites

пробелы в путях, длинные пути, где-нибудь всё же затесались не англицкие буквы...

18.3 по 25.1 живут на вин10.

пс: ну или проект в студию...

не забываем про любые разновидности антивирусов - они тупо (молча) могут "удалить" нужный "исполняемый" файл от вивады.

и вообщее гугл знает больше 10 аналогичных вопросов...

Edited by Alex77

Share this post


Link to post
Share on other sites

1 час назад, Alex77 сказал:

пробелы в путях, длинные пути, где-нибудь всё же затесались не англицкие буквы...

Пробелов нет, латиницу и кириллицу проверил не один раз, что есть длинный путь? 

 

1 час назад, Alex77 сказал:

пс: ну или проект в студию...

 Arty.rar . Это проект от  Alex Forencich

1 час назад, Alex77 сказал:

не забываем про любые разновидности антивирусов - они тупо (молча) могут "удалить" нужный "исполняемый" файл от вивады.

При установке vivado все отключал, но в процессе работы антивирус работает

 

1 час назад, Alex77 сказал:

и вообщее гугл знает больше 10 аналогичных вопросов...

Перед тем как написать сюда, я прошерстил интернет) но к сожалению, решения не нашел 

Share this post


Link to post
Share on other sites

48 минут назад, Runi сказал:

Пробелов нет, латиницу и кириллицу проверил не один раз, что есть длинный путь? 

 Arty.rar . Это проект от  Alex Forencich

При установке vivado все отключал, но в процессе работы антивирус работает

1)это когда x:/genm/genm/file.h длиньше 250 (256 ?) символов

2) проект открывается адекватно. собрал в 18.3.

3) вот вот - вот тут может порыться собака. снести всё (в том числе антивирус) - поставить только виваду.

"не забываем про любые разновидности антивирусов - они тупо (молча) могут "удалить ФИЗИЧЕСКИ" нужный "исполняемый" файл от вивады."

ПС: имя пользователя ? пробел в имени пользователя ?

*.log файл в студию

Edited by Alex77

Share this post


Link to post
Share on other sites

17 минут назад, Alex77 сказал:

2) проект открывается адекватно. собрал в 18.3.

Какая у Вас версия win?

 

17 минут назад, Alex77 сказал:

ПС: имя пользователя ? пробел в имени пользователя ?

Все без пробелов и на английском 

Share this post


Link to post
Share on other sites

1) в окне тикля что кажет ?

2) вручную топ можно выставить ?

3) удалить все каталоги(файлы) проекта. оставить только /rtl исходники) и fpga.xpr

открыть проект в виваде.

4) вручную создать с нуля проект. потом добавлять по одному файлу, начиная с топа.

Edited by Alex77

Share this post


Link to post
Share on other sites

2 минуты назад, Alex77 сказал:

1) в оне тикля что кажет ?

2025-12-09_16-35-05.png

3 минуты назад, Alex77 сказал:

2) вручную топ можно выставить

2025-12-09_16-38-39.thumb.png.2ee5f836dc942ad55e89881a883f5e5a.png

 

Задать нельзя. А вписать в настройках вручную имя топ модуля можно, но это ничего не дает 

Share this post


Link to post
Share on other sites

Все аналогично. Попробую переустановить vivado отключив все антивирусы и запустить без них

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...